Acurx Pharmaceuticals, Inc. (NASDAQ:ACXP) Sees Significant Growth in Short Interest

Acurx Pharmaceuticals, Inc. (NASDAQ:ACXPGet Free Report) saw a significant growth in short interest in March. As of March 13th, there was short interest totaling 1,045,893 shares, a growth of 1,712.4% from the February 26th total of 57,707 shares. Currently, 46.0% of the shares of the stock are sold short. Based on an average daily volume of 16,051,851 shares, the days-to-cover ratio is currently 0.1 days.

Acurx Pharmaceuticals, Inc, headquartered in King of Prussia, Pennsylvania, is a clinical‐stage biopharmaceutical company focused on the discovery and development of novel anti‐infective therapies. The company’s research platform leverages insights into bacterial virulence regulation and quorum sensing pathways to design small-molecule candidates aimed at reducing pathogen toxicity and biofilm formation. By targeting key mechanisms of infection rather than bacterial viability alone, Acurx seeks to offer differentiated treatment options that may help address the growing challenge of antibiotic resistance.

Acurx’s lead product candidates are being developed to treat acute bacterial skin and skin structure infections (ABSSSI), including cases caused by drug-resistant strains such as methicillin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us (MRSA).
